static struct mxc_usbh_platform_data otg_pdata = {
	.portsc	= MXC_EHCI_MODE_ULPI,
	.flags	= MXC_EHCI_INTERFACE_DIFF_UNI,
};

static struct mxc_usbh_platform_data usbh2_pdata = {
	.portsc	= MXC_EHCI_MODE_ULPI,
	.flags	= MXC_EHCI_INTERFACE_DIFF_UNI,
};

static struct fsl_usb2_platform_data otg_device_pdata = {
	.operating_mode = FSL_USB2_DR_DEVICE,
	.phy_mode       = FSL_USB2_PHY_ULPI,
};

static int otg_mode_host;

static int __init eukrea_cpuimx27_otg_mode(char *options)
{
	if (!strcmp(options, "host"))
		otg_mode_host = 1;
	else if (!strcmp(options, "device"))
		otg_mode_host = 0;
	else
		pr_info("otg_mode neither \"host\" nor \"device\". "
			"Defaulting to device\n");
	return 0;
}
__setup("otg_mode=", eukrea_cpuimx27_otg_mode);

#if defined(CONFIG_USB_ULPI)
	if (otg_mode_host) {
		otg_pdata.otg = otg_ulpi_create(&mxc_ulpi_access_ops,
				USB_OTG_DRV_VBUS | USB_OTG_DRV_VBUS_EXT);

		mxc_register_device(&mxc_otg_host, &otg_pdata);
	}

	usbh2_pdata.otg = otg_ulpi_create(&mxc_ulpi_access_ops,
				USB_OTG_DRV_VBUS | USB_OTG_DRV_VBUS_EXT);

	mxc_register_device(&mxc_usbh2, &usbh2_pdata);
#endif
	if (!otg_mode_host)
		mxc_register_device(&mxc_otg_udc_device, &otg_device_pdata);
